Complex signal decomposition and modeling
First Claim
1. An apparatus for monitoring the operating condition of a system, comprising:
- sensor means for acquiring a single time-varying signal characterizing operation of the system;
means for decomposing said single time-varying signal into a plurality of components represented by vectors of actual component values, each vector having actual component values each at least partially representing the same moment in time;
a memory for storing a plurality of reference snapshots of reference component values for known operating conditions; and
processor means responsive to the decomposing means, disposed to generate estimates of the component values using an example-based multivariate empirical modeling engine using a calculation that uses both the reference component values and the vectors of actual component values to calculate expected component values for each vector of actual component values, andfurther disposed to generate residual values by differencing the actual component values and the expected component values, for determination of deviating operating conditions of the system.

Abstract
A system, method and program product for monitoring a complex signal for ultrasensitive detection of state changes, or for signature recognition and classification is provided. A complex signal is decomposed periodically for empirical modeling. Wavelet analysis, frequency band filtering or other methods may be used to decompose the complex signal into components. A library of signature data may be referenced for selection of a recognized signature in the decomposed complex signal. The recognized signature may indicate data being carried in the complex signal. Estimated signal data may be generated for determination of an operational state of a monitored process or machine using a statistical hypothesis test with reference to the decomposed input signal.

9. A method for monitoring the operating condition of a system, comprising the steps of:
-
acquiring a single time-varying signal characterizing operation of the system; periodically extracting observations of features from the single time-varying signal, each feature relating to a component signal represented by actual component values, the actual component values each at least partially representing the same moment in time, and wherein the actual component values are wavelet coefficients for said single time-varying signal; generating estimates, by a processor, for at least one of the extracted features responsive to extracting an observation of features, using an example-based multivariate empirical modeling engine using a calculation with both the actual component values and reference component values stored in a library of feature observations characteristic of acceptable operation of said system to calculate expected component values; and differencing, by a processor, at least one of said expected component values with corresponding actual component values to produce residuals for determination of deviating operating conditions of said system. - View Dependent Claims (10, 11, 12)
